Transaction 8ab16456cdaacf93f101f53577f524c5dbae9e2cf887625c24831c98fc3ddc5f
1 Input
1 Output
-
8ab16456cdaacf93f101f53577f524c5dbae9e2cf887625c24831c98fc3ddc5f:0
- value
- 449166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c752baef8912c4f5daa7bb30a50c4029d604a0bd OP_EQUAL
- address
- 3KrwVuywFhVREXuD9RFsN7qmKVQZoUfMMY